Freelance Translators Obtaining Security Clearance

Aside from large translation corporations, there is a competitive landscape for freelance translators in Canada. Research estimates that there are approximately 15,000 freelance translators, interpreters, and localization specialists in Canada. With this being said, freelance workers are encouraged to expand their certifications and skill set in order to give them an edge in a large... Continue Reading →

Blog at

Up ↑